Output 3f56b2bcbda423248a7612e020f695a453184c859a3145e3d750bf5020539504:0

value
18608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ef83bb91b86640bd52eba008c525aa58bb855fd3 OP_EQUALVERIFY OP_CHECKSIG
address
1NqSJo8hJRJzmYaTBbd3FMN3qxS2VAvfFk
transaction
3f56b2bcbda423248a7612e020f695a453184c859a3145e3d750bf5020539504
confirmations
332883
spent
true